The Importance of Using Container Shelters on Construction Sites

Construction sites can be hazardous places, and it is essential to take all necessary precautions to ensure the safety of workers and equipment. One of the most effective ways to do this is by using container shelters on construction sites. Benefits of Using Container Shelters

  • Protection from the Elements

One of the most significant benefits of using container shelters on construction sites is that they provide protection from the elements. This includes protection from rain, wind, and extreme temperatures, which can be dangerous for workers and equipment. Container shelters can also help to keep construction sites dry and prevent damage to materials and equipment.

  • Improved Safety

Another benefit of using container shelters on construction sites is that they can improve safety. Container shelters can provide a safe and secure place for workers to take shelter during extreme weather conditions, such as thunderstorms or high winds. Additionally, container shelters can be used to store equipment, tools, and materials, which can help to keep the construction site organized and reduce the risk of accidents.

  • Increased Productivity

Using container shelters on construction sites can also increase productivity. Container shelters can be used to create a comfortable working environment, which can help to reduce fatigue and improve the overall morale of workers. Additionally, container shelters can be used to store equipment, tools, and materials, which can make it easier for workers to find what they need and work more efficiently.

  • Cost-Effective

Finally, using container shelters on construction sites is a cost-effective solution. Container shelters are typically less expensive than traditional structures and can be easily transported to different construction sites. Additionally, container shelters can be modified or expanded as needed, which can help to save money in the long run.

How to Use Container Shelters on Construction Sites?

  • Site Preparation

Before installing a container shelter on a construction site, it is essential to prepare the site. This includes leveling the ground and making sure that it is stable enough to support the weight of the container shelter. Additionally, it is essential to check for underground utilities, such as gas and electrical lines, to avoid damaging them during installation.

  • Installation

Once the site is prepared, the container shelter can be installed. This typically involves placing the container shelter on a prepared foundation, such as a concrete slab, and securing it in place. It is essential to make sure that the container shelter is level and that all necessary connections, such as electrical and plumbing, are made.

  • Customization

Container shelters can be customized to meet the specific needs of a construction site. This can include adding windows, doors, and other features, such as insulation and ventilation. Additionally, container shelter can be expanded or modified as needed, which can help to make them more versatile and useful on construction sites.

Conclusion

Using container shelters on construction sites is an effective way to protect workers and equipment from the elements, improve safety, and increase productivity. Container shelters are also cost-effective and can be customized to meet the specific needs of a construction site. By taking the time to prepare the site, properly install the container shelter, and customize it to meet the specific needs of a construction site, construction companies can ensure that they are getting the most out of this versatile and valuable tool.
